Bacon and Tomato Salad might be just the side dish you are searching for. This gluten free, dairy free, and whole 30 recipe serves 6. One serving contains 496 calories, 10g of protein, and 46g of fat. From preparation to the plate, this recipe takes around 30 minutes.
